À propos de ce yacht

Artemis is a 2018 Dufour 412 Grand large based at D-Marin Marina Gouvia in Kerkyra, offering the perfect platform for exploring the Ionian Islands and the Albanian coast. This well-appointed 12-metre sailing yacht combines thoughtful design with genuine comfort, making it ideal for families, groups of friends, or couples seeking a week of unhurried discovery across some of the Mediterranean's most unspoiled waters.

The yacht accommodates eight guests across three cabins, with two full heads ensuring everyone enjoys their own private space. Below deck, you'll find a properly equipped galley with refrigeration for provisioning local produce and fresh catches, while the radio-CD system provides entertainment during quieter anchorages. On deck, the bimini and sprayhood keep you sheltered during passage and at rest, transforming the cockpit into a comfortable hub for morning coffee or evening aperitifs. The lazy jacks and lazy bag system make sail handling straightforward, even for less experienced crews, while the 40 hp engine and autopilot grant both confidence and ease when conditions demand it.

A typical week unfolds with morning swims in crystalline coves, lazy lunches ashore in villages where time moves differently, and sunlit passages between islands. The solar panels ensure your batteries stay topped up, while the included dinghy opens access to beaches and tavernas that larger vessels cannot reach. From Kerkyra, you might sail south toward Paxos and Antipaxos, where turquoise waters meet limestone cliffs, or venture north toward the Diapontian Islands—each day revealing another reason why sailors return to these waters year after year.
